Organic luminescent materials are very sensitive to external stimuli, such as pressure, temperature, and electric field. The luminescent properties of some organic luminescent materials significantly change under high pressure. Some materials may show luminescence discoloration, whereas some may exhibit luminescence enhancement. These properties have many potential applications in anticounterfeiting, force sensor, data recording and storage, and luminescent devices, thereby greatly attracting the attention of scientists. In this review, the progress of research on these materials at high pressure in recent years is summarized.
